What is the Portugal Golden Visa?

Established in 2012, the Golde Visa is a program that will grant third-country nationals a temporary residence permit through an investment activity in Portugal, allowing you to:

Enter Portugal without a residence visa.

Reside, study, and work in Portugal, or stay just 7 days a year.

Circulate in the Schengen area without a visa.

Benefit from family reunification (spouse, children, parents, parents-in-law).

Gain access to health care, social protection, and the educational system.

Apply for permanent residence after 5 years.

Apply for Portuguese nationality after 5 years.

What Kind Of Investments Are Eligible?

Acquisition of shares in non-real estate collective investment entities (Investment Funds) €500K

Activities of artistic output, reconstruction or maintenance of the national heritage for €250K as a sponsorship

Research activities in the scientific or technologic areas for €500K

10 Jobs creation

Companies incorporation or capital reinforcement of €500K + 5 job position

Acquisition of shares in non-real estate collective investment entities (Investment Funds) €500K

The investment must be maintained for at least the duration of the Golden Visa

At least 60% of the capital of the fund must be invested in Portuguese companies

The funds must have a minimum maturity of 5 years

The fund must be registered with CMVM

What are the Investment Funds Requirements?

The applicant must be a non-EU/EEA/Swiss citizen

The main applicant must be at least 18 years old

Clean criminal record from their current country of residence and Portugal

Obtain a Portuguese Tax ID number (NIF)

Open a bank account in Portugal after obtaining a Portuguese tax ID number (NIF)

All non-Portuguese documents need to be legalized through an apostille and translated into Portuguese

The investment capital to fund the investment must come out of Portugal, and the investor must be ready to prove the legality of the origin of funds

The investor must hold the investment for at least 5 years
